Area contextNeighborhood Overview – Cleveland Institute of Art (Cleveland, OH)
Nestled within the heart of Cleveland's renowned University Circle, the Cleveland Institute of Art is positioned among a dense concentration of cultural, educational, and healthcare institutions. Access to the CIA is primarily via Euclid Avenue, a major thoroughfare that connects downtown Cleveland to the eastern suburbs. For those arriving by car, Interstate 90 offers convenient access from various points of the city and beyond, with exits guiding drivers towards University Circle. Public transportation is robust; the Greater Cleveland Regional Transit Authority (RTA) operates multiple bus lines and the HealthLine bus rapid transit on Euclid Avenue, providing direct service to stops just steps from campus. The RTA Red Line rapid transit also serves the area with a station at University Circle. Cleveland Hopkins International Airport (CLE) is approximately 10-12 miles west of the institute, with typical drive times ranging from 20 to 35 minutes depending on traffic conditions, or about 40-50 minutes via RTA rail and bus connections. Rideshare services are readily available, offering a direct route from the airport and throughout the city. For optimal arrival, consider arriving at least 30-45 minutes prior to any scheduled event or appointment to account for potential traffic, especially during peak hours, and to locate parking or your specific building entrance with ease.

Things to Do Near Cleveland Institute of Art
Walkable
Cleveland Museum of Art
The Cleveland Museum of Art, directly adjacent to the CIA, offers an extraordinary collection spanning 6,000 years of human creativity from around the world. Its extensive galleries feature everything from ancient Egyptian artifacts and European masterpieces to contemporary installations and Asian art. Admission to the permanent collection is free, making it an accessible and enriching experience for all visitors. Exploring its diverse wings can easily fill several hours, with highlights that include works by Monet, Picasso, and Warhol. The museum also hosts rotating special exhibitions and educational programs, providing constant opportunities for discovery and inspiration for art lovers and students alike.
University Circle · On siteCleveland Botanical Garden
Part of Holden Forests & Gardens, the Cleveland Botanical Garden offers a tranquil oasis within the bustling University Circle. Its Glasshouse features diverse ecosystems, transporting visitors to the desert of Madagascar and the rainforests of Costa Rica, complete with exotic plants and vibrant butterflies. Outdoor gardens provide seasonal beauty and thematic landscapes, perfect for a leisurely stroll. The garden also hosts workshops, events, and educational programs, providing a refreshing break and a unique sensory experience. It’s an ideal spot for quiet contemplation or a picturesque outing.

Severance Music Center
Home to the world-renowned Cleveland Orchestra, Severance Music Center is a landmark of architectural beauty and acoustic excellence. Even if you aren't attending a performance, the building itself is worth admiring. The orchestra offers a diverse season of classical music, popular concerts, and family-friendly events, drawing international acclaim for its artistry. Attending a performance here is a quintessential Cleveland cultural experience, offering an evening of sophisticated entertainment and world-class music in an unforgettable setting. Check their schedule for upcoming performances and matinees.

The expansive campus of Case Western Reserve University, a major research institution, is adjacent to the Cleveland Institute of Art. Visitors can explore the beautiful grounds, visit the Maltz Performing Arts Center, or take advantage of the university's public resources like the Kelvin Smith Library. The university's presence adds to the intellectual and cultural vibrancy of University Circle, with numerous public lectures, exhibitions, and sporting events that are often open to the wider community. Walking through campus offers a glimpse into academic life and provides picturesque views of historic and modern architecture.
